Research Backgrounds
May play an integral structural role in elastic-fiber architectural organization and/or assembly.
N-Glycosylated.
Contains hydroxylated asparagine residues.
Secreted>Extracellular space>Extracellular matrix.
Expressed in the aorta (at protein level). Expressed in lung, weakly expressed in heart, placenta, liver and skeletal muscle.
Forms part of the large latent transforming growth factor beta precursor complex; removal is essential for activation of complex. Interacts with SDC4. Interacts (via C-terminal domain) with FBN1 (via N-terminal domain) in a Ca(+2)-dependent manner.
Belongs to the LTBP family.
